The Core Meaning and Common Phrases
At its core, a friend suggestion in Urdu is about proposing a connection with someone. This could be someone you may know indirectly through a mutual friend, someone who's part of the same group or community, or someone whose profile or activities align with your interests. You might come across phrases like "dost banana ki sifarish" (دوست بنانے کی سفارش), which literally means "recommendation for making a friend." While not a direct translation of "friend suggestion," it conveys the intended function of the feature. Another frequently used expression is "dosti ki peshkash" (دوستی کی پیشکش), which translates to "an offer of friendship." These phrases highlight the proactive nature of friend suggestions, suggesting that the platform or the system is proactively providing recommendations. Sometimes, you might see simpler, more casual expressions, like "dost banayen" (دوست بنائیں), meaning "make friends." The context in which these phrases are used will vary depending on the platform, the user's level of formality, and the specific dynamics of the interaction. The Role of Social Media Platforms
Social media platforms play a huge role in how friend suggestions are presented and used. Facebook, Instagram, Twitter, LinkedIn, and other platforms use different algorithms to determine which people to suggest as friends. These algorithms analyze user data, such as mutual friends, shared interests, location, and professional connections. The information presented with the friend suggestion can also vary across platforms. Some may show a photo, a short bio, and a list of mutual friends. Others might provide more detailed information, such as shared groups or interests. On platforms like Facebook, friend suggestions are often based on a wide range of factors, including your location, mutual friends, and shared interests. Instagram relies heavily on mutual followers, and people you've interacted with. LinkedIn focuses on professional connections, suggesting people based on job title, industry, and previous work experience.
